Transaction 291fc113e171c462e21a4354fe9e13edc6e56af9862bb1890eca4b4f78640396
1 Input
1 Output
-
291fc113e171c462e21a4354fe9e13edc6e56af9862bb1890eca4b4f78640396:0
- value
- 29880000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c318b66eb08cbfeb726e305a8bf46b79ac2eab1a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JnaNUHAZegxUMFLxBgn9hg7MaJFVoM2Tr